Transaction 63d8dc893479bbd236d478581fad62c683d88fde73ab7fe974c8d90d4c94915c
1 Input
1 Output
-
63d8dc893479bbd236d478581fad62c683d88fde73ab7fe974c8d90d4c94915c:0
- value
- 9656530
- script pubkey
- OP_0 OP_PUSHBYTES_20 08c1c23696c3d0971948eef929dc88c9230c11dc
- address
- bc1qprquyd5kc0gfwx2gamujnhygey3scywujurcwa